InsideView Raises $11.5 Million Series B Round

Company Continues Expansion and Product Innovation in Sales Intelligence and Social Selling Technologies


SAN FRANCISCO, CA--(Marketwire - March 31, 2010) -  InsideView, Inc. today announced that it closed $11.5 million in Series B financing led by current investors Emergence Capital Partners, Rembrandt Venture Partners and Greenhouse Capital Partners. The new financing will be used to expand new customer acquisition efforts and scale user adoption and customer success, while accelerating the company's investment in product development. InsideView's unique and award-winning sales intelligence solution, SalesView, continuously aggregates executive and corporate data from tens of thousands of content sources, bringing the most relevant information to sales users at the right time and within their existing sales process. SalesView maximizes sales team productivity by automatically identifying compelling business events and people-to-people connections, while accelerating sales cycles by enabling sales people to call the right prospects at the right time. SalesView delivers this intelligence natively within the leading CRM systems for optimum usability.

About InsideView
InsideView is a Sales 2.0 leader, bringing intelligence gained from social media and traditional editorial sources to the enterprise to increase sales productivity and velocity. InsideView's award-winning sales intelligence solution, SalesView, continuously aggregates and analyzes relevant executive and corporate data from thousands of content sources to uncover new sales opportunities. SalesView delivers this intelligence natively within CRMs and mobile devices for optimum usability. The San Francisco-based company was founded in 2005 and is venture-backed by Emergence Capital Partners, Rembrandt Venture Partners and Greenhouse Capital Partners. InsideView's products are used by more than 26,000 sales professionals and more than 2,000 companies worldwide, including Adobe, BMC, CapGemini, IBM, Polycom and VMWare.
